For those of you that haven’t heard :: Bea Arthur becomes a mother to Larry David
It’s a casting choice made in TV heaven, as the inimitable Beatrice Arthur reveals she’ll be going in next week to play Larry David’s mother on a future installment of “Curb Your Enthusiasm.”
What, you say Larry’s mother died in season three of the HBO hit? Well, you’re right, but why should that stop them?
“I’m doing a dream sequence. I’m just thrilled to do that show. I can’t wait,” says the Broadway great, whose TV contributions include “Maude” and “The Golden Girls” — the latter of which gets its second-season DVD release today. She notes, “There are so few shows I really watch. I love ‘The Daily Show’ and ‘Curb Your Enthusiasm,’ and other than that it’s news or old movies.”

Speaking of which, According to Rue McClanahan, the DVD of the third season of “The Golden Girls” is being released in November (22nd). Because Rue is currently appearing in Broadway’s “Wicked” (and can’t get away for a few months), Bea and Betty White are due to fly to NYC for a signing.

Bea Arthur will be part of the 25th anniversary of PETA on September 10th. The gala and humanitarian awards show will be at the Paramount Pictures in Hollywood on that Saturday.
